Economic Environment
– Economic stages that exists at a given time in a country
– Economic Problems
– Functioning of economy
• Economic Indices such as
• National Income - total amount of money earned within a country.
• Per Capital Income, - average income earned per person in a given area (city, region, country, etc.)
in a specified year.
• Disposable Income - income remaining after deduction of taxes and social security charges,
available to be spent or saved as one wishes.
• Rate of growth of GNP - total value of goods produced and services provided by a country during
one year, equal to the gross domestic product plus the net income from foreign investments.
• Distribution of Income - equality with which income is dealt out among members of a society.
• Rate of savings - amount of money, expressed as a percentage or ratio, that a person deducts
from his disposable personal income to set aside for future financial goals.
